What is CVE-2020-36880?

A local buffer overflow vulnerability exists in Flexsense DiskBoss version 7.7.14 within the 'Reports and Data Directory' field. This flaw enables an attacker to potentially execute arbitrary code on the affected system, leading to unauthorized actions and compromises in system security. Users and administrators are advised to review their configurations and apply necessary updates to mitigate the risk.
